Abstract

The utility model discloses a heat needling. One end of the body of the heat needling is a fixed needle tip, the other end of the body of the heat needling is a needle tip of servo reciprocation, and a spring is nested on the needle body. A spring forcer is arranged at one end of the spring, the other end of the spring is positioned on an adjusting inner screw, on which a fixation machine button is arranged, and the length of the needle body exposed outside a needle cylinder can be adjusted by the adjusting inner screw. Heat-dissipating holes and servo distance-adjusting holes are arranged on the needle cylinder, and the spring can regulate the strength of needle insertion. The heat needling can accurately control the depth of needle insertion, and the operation is very convenient.

Heat needling
This utility model relates to a kind of new type medical equipment, particularly a kind of fiery pin.
The fire pin is the traditional legacy in the Chinese medical treasure-house, has had very long applicating history at China's medical domain, and it has unique effect for treatment multiple chronic disease (as rheumatic arthritis, chronic bronchitis etc.).But traditional fiery pin is to make needle-like by a metallic, and during use, a hand-held end places needle tip and burns redly on the flame, thrusts predetermined acupuncture point then rapidly, extracts immediately.There is following defective in fiery pin like this: at first be that depth of needle can't accurately be controlled; Next is because of conduction of heat causes the handgrip part temperature drift, is unfavorable for operation.
The purpose of this utility model is in order to remedy above-mentioned defective, can accurately to control depth of needle thereby provide a kind of, and the novel fiery pin that helps operating.
The purpose of this utility model adopts following technical scheme to realize:
The other end of the fixedly needle point of the fiery pin of tradition is processed into the reciprocal needle point of servo-actuated, the adjustment screw is made at the middle part of needle body, adjust the screw place at this one adjustment internal thread is installed, on the adjustment internal thread, fixed machine button is installed, in adjustment internal thread outer setting syringe is arranged, this syringe inner surface is level and smooth with adjustment internal thread outer surface and contacts, end at syringe is equipped with the spring top, circle centre position in this spring top offers the circular hole that can supply needle body to pass, on needle body, be with spring, one end of spring contacts with the spring top, other end overhead is in adjusting on the internal thread, spring can be along needle body inserting needle direction generation deformation, offers louvre at an end of syringe, offers servo-actuated roll adjustment hole at the other end of syringe, servo-actuated roll adjustment hole can be subjected to displacement for fixed machine button, end offers the adjustment breach in one of servo-actuated roll adjustment hole, when fixed machine button enters the adjustment breach, needle body can be fixed.
Because this utility model has adopted technique scheme, so needling length and dynamics all can be adjusted, and also very favourable to operation.
